Step-by-Step Instructions
- Preheat a large skillet or wok over medium-high heat for about 2 minutes. Lightly coat with cooking spray.
- Add sliced flank steak and stir-fry for 3-4 minutes until browned. Remove from pan.
- Sauté minced garlic and grated ginger for 30 seconds until fragrant. Stir frequently.
- Add bok choy stems and red bell pepper, stir-frying for 2-3 minutes until tender yet crisp.
- Return flank steak to the pan and mix with vegetables. Pour in soy sauce, rice vinegar, and sesame oil.
- Mix cornstarch with water until smooth, then pour into skillet while stirring. Cook until sauce thickens.
- Serve immediately, garnished with green onions and sesame seeds.

Notes
Slice flank steak against the grain for maximum tenderness. Don't overcrowd the pan when cooking.
